Synqly Python SDK

This repository contains the SynqlyPythonClient SDK package, which can be used to integrate a Python application with Synqly APIs. All Synqly SDKs require a valid Synqly Organization token to use.

Import the SDK

To install the SynqlyPythonClient to your local Python environment, run the following command:

pip3 install git+https://github.com/Synqly/python-sdk.git

You should now be able to import packages from the SynqlyPythonClient as follows:

from synqly import engine
from synqly import management as mgmt

For more detailed examples of how to use the Synqly Python SDK, please refer to the examples directory in this repository. Each sub-directory in examples contains a standalone example of how to work with a particular Synqly Connector.

Local Development

While the files under /src are auto-generated, it can sometimes be useful to install a local copy of the SDK in order to debug issues such as type mismatches. The following command will install the local version of SynqlyPythonClient, overriding the upstream repository.

cd ~/python-sdk

pip install -e .
